A Visit to Puig i Cova de Sant Marti
Puig i Cova de Sant Marti is a beautiful area situated about 5,5 km. from Alcudia. Holidaymakers may do walking, horseback riding and biking trips in Puig i Cova de Sant Marti. In addition, paragliding or hang-gliding from the top of the hills is also popular for the extreme sports lovers. The cave of Sant Marti is also worth a visit and see.
Palma de Mallorca City Sightseeing
Palma de Mallorca is the capital city of Majorca and located about 59 km. from Alcudia. A great day out in Palma de Mallorca is a great attraction. Holidaymakers may explore Palma de Mallorca by city sightseeing buses. There are many beautiful and historical places to see in Palma de Mallorca that include; the Bellver Castle, sa Llotja (old commercial exchange), the La Almudaina Royal Palace (the old Citadel) and the La Seu Cathedral.
